Troubleshooting guide, continued
Identify the problem in the left-hand column and follow the instructions on the right:
Unstable operation, with
wide variation in air flow
rates.
The unit is probably set to
Automatic On-Demand
Mode, which will vary the air
flow as required in the house
and the relative humidity in
the outside air.
The unit is not defective.
It is recommended that you
set the unit to Manual Op-
eration and choose the ap-
propriate fan step (usually
Fan Step 3). It is not advis-
able to operate at air flow
rates below the statutory
rate required for the house
as this may result in the
risk of damage from damp
and reduced air quality.
The house is becoming un-
necessarily dry.
The unit may be running
with too high a level of air
replacement for the size
and use of the house.
Check that the unit's air flow
is appropriate to the size and
use of the house by checking
the unit's air flow according
to the initial adjustment pro-
cedure.
The unit has been manually
set to operate with the
nominal air replacement
(Fan Step 3) in Manual
Mode. Very dry indoor cli-
mates occur particularly in
winter when the outside air
is very dry.
Set the unit to Automatic
Mode or turn the unit down
to Fan Step 2 or 1 in Manu-
al Mode.
Using Fan Step 2 or 1
is only recommended for a
short period of time.
